The Guilford sets off cars in Brunswick for Maine Eastern

The Guilford Train from Rigby sets of six covered hoppers in the East Yard in Brunswick, Maine. 2 are empty cement hoppers and the others may be perlite for Chemrock in Rockland.

Photographed by Eric Tongren, November, 2005.
Added to the photo archive by Eric Tongren, December 26, 2005.
Railroad: Guilford (MEC).
